Though it wouldn't be fair to compare Mildred Pierce to the 1945 film adaptation of James M. Cain's novel, you can't help but notice how immaculately both versions bring the source material to life. In Todd Haynes' rendition, Kate Winslet leads the family melodrama as a mother battling for her daughter's respect.

Mildred Pierce is a beautiful if tragic drama that perfectly captures the fractured relationship between Mildred and Veda Pierce whilst also painting a fresh picture of life during the Great Depression. There are some blips, particularly with its five-hour length, but when the acting, tone and message is this strong, such scruples are easy to forgive.
